Sr. Software Engineer ( C++)

Application deadline closed.

Job Description

Sr. Software Engineer ( C++)

Job highlights
5+ years of experience in Object Oriented Design and development using C++ in a Windows environment; Bachelor’s or Master’s degree in Computer Science or equivalent

Design and implement software solutions, perform systems analysis, lead project teams, and mentor junior staff
Job match score

Early Applicant

Key Skills

Location

Work Experience

5 – 10 Years

Not mentioned

Not disclosed

Bengaluru
Must have key skills
c++,software development,oops,object oriented development,troubleshooting
Other key skills
oracle,application design,unit testing,hibernate,sql server,sql,spring,java,product development,system performance,debugging,scrum,software engineering,agile,protocols
Job description
What you’ll do
Your Impact:

OpenText is the market leader in Enterprise Information Management platforms and applications. As a Software Engineer you will utilize your knowledge and experience to perform systems analysis, research, maintenance, troubleshooting and other programming activities. You become a member of one of our Agile based project teams, focusing on product development. It is an exciting opportunity to design and implement solutions for enterprise level systems.
OpenText Business Network is a modern cloud platform that helps manage the full data lifecycle, from information capture and exchange to integration and governance.
Business Network solutions establish the necessary digital backbone for streamlined connectivity, secure collaboration, and real-time business intelligence across an expanding network of internal systems, cloud applications, trading partner systems and connected devices.

What the role offers:

Designs enhancements, updates, and programming changes for portions and subsystems of end-user applications software running on local, networked, and Internet-based platforms.
Analyzes design and determines coding, programming, and integration activities required based on general objectives and knowledge of the overall architecture of the product or solution.
Writes and executes complete unit testing, protocols, and documentation for assigned portion of application; identifies and debugs and creates solutions for issues with code and integration into application architecture.
Leads a project team of other software applications engineers and internal and outsourced development partners to develop reliable, cost-effective, and high-quality solutions for assigned applications portion or subsystem.
Collaborates and communicates with management, internal, and outsourced development partners regarding software applications design status, project progress, and issue resolution.
Represents the software applications engineering team for all phases of larger and more complex development projects.
Provides guidance and mentoring to less-experienced staff members.
What you need to succeed:

5+ years with Object Oriented Design and development using C++ in Windows environment
Databases (MS SQL / Oracle)
Bachelor’s or masters degree in computer science, Information Systems, or equivalent.
5 -8 years of software development experience building large-scale and highly distributed application
Designing software applications running on multiple platform types.
Software applications development methodology, including writing and execution of unit test cases and debugging, and testing scripts and tools.
Strong analytical, problem solving and troubleshooting skills.
Ability to adapt to new tools & technologies
Excellent written and verbal communication skills.
Ability to effectively communicate product architectures, design proposals and negotiate options at management levels.
Familiarity with agile software development with experience driving product backlogs, as well as actively leading scrum team.
Industry type
Software Product
Department
Engineering – Software & QA
Role
Technical Lead
Role category
Software Development
Employment type
Full Time, Permanent
Education
Any Graduate, Any Postgraduate

Create an alert for similar jobs
Technical Lead, Bengaluru

About company
Open Text™ is the world’s largest independent provider of Enterprise Content Management software. The Company’s solutions manage information for all types of business, compliance and industry requirements in the world’s largest companies, government agencies and professional service firms. Open Text supports approximately 46,000 customers and millions of users in 114 countries and 12 languages.
Open Text offers an attractive and unique opportunity to be part of one of the fastest growing success stories in the Information Technology sector. Our talented and innovative team creates solutions that truly influence the way leading organizations do business. Imagine having the resources to influence tomorrow’s reality today, learning from the industries top talent and having fun while you do it! We are looking for people who think outside the box, dream big, thrive on change and innovate for today and tomorrow – people a lot like you.
At Open Text we believe in the diversity of our work force. Our people are our number one winning strategy which is why we strive to attract and retain the very best the industry has to offer. We are proud to offer excellent benefits, a high performance culture, challenging work and highly competitive financial rewards.
We currently have a wide range of attractive opportunities whether you are a new grad or a seasoned professional. Explore the opportunities, choose Open Text, be part of the story. Let your journey begin.
Website
http://www.opentext.com
Headquarters
.